2 Piggy Bank A child has 25 coins in a piggy bank consisting of dimes and quarters. The total value of the coins is $3.70. Find the number of dimes and the number of quarters.

3 Piggy Bank We have two unknowns in this problem,
Let d = Let q = We have two totals we are concerned with, The total number of ____________ The total amount of ____________

4 Piggy Bank How can we verbally represent the total number of coins?
How can we algebraically represent the total number of coins?

5 Piggy Bank How can we verbally represent the total amount of money in the piggy bank? How can we algebraically represent the total amount of money in the piggy bank?

6 Piggy Bank We have two linear equations – what should we do??

12 The Entrepreneur Lavely Inc. has daily fixed costs from salaries, rent, and other operations of $600. Each widget Lavely Inc makes costs $25 and sells for $45. a.) Determine the cost C of producing x widgets per day.

13 The Entrepreneur b.) Determine the revenue R of selling x widgets per day.

14 The Entrepreneur c.) Graph the cost and revenue functions – what does the intersection represent?
